The Hartsbrook School is seeking applicants for a full-time High School chair position to lead the high school beginning in the 2023 school year. The High School Chair, in collaboration with the Faculty Conference, oversees all aspects of the pedagogy and administration of the high school and ensures support for and alignment with the mission and values of the Hartsbrook School.

The role includes some teaching, determined by the strengths and background of the applicant, in the interest of having a direct experience of the students.
